A can do a piece of work in 10 days; B in 15 days. They work for 5 days. The rest of the work was finished by C in 2 days. If they get Rs. 1500 for the whole work, the daily wages of B and C are:

Answer: Rs. 225
Explanation
Step 1: Work Done by A and B Together
  • A’s 1-day work = 1/10
  • B’s 1-day work = 1/15
  • A and B’s 1-day work together:
  • Work done by A and B in 5 days:
Step 2: Work Left for C
  • Total work = 1
  • Work remaining after A and B worked for 5 days:
    1 - frac{5}{6} = frac{1}{6}
  • C completes the remaining 1/6 of the work in 2 days, so C’s 1-day work:
Step 3: Wages Calculation
  • Total amount = Rs. 1500

  • Work done ratio:

    • A's total work = 510=12frac{5}{10} = frac{1}{2}
    • B's total work = 515=13frac{5}{15} = frac{1}{3}
    • C's total work = 212=16frac{2}{12} = frac{1}{6}
  • Share of wages:

    • A's share = 12×1500=750frac{1}{2} times 1500 = 750
    • B's share = 13×1500=500frac{1}{3} times 1500 = 500
    • C's share = 16×1500=250frac{1}{6} times 1500 = 250
  • Daily wages:

    • B worked 5 days, so B’s daily wage = 500/5 = Rs. 100
    • C worked 2 days, so C’s daily wage = 250/2 = Rs. 125
    • 100+125 = 225
